TRACER SYSTEM TQ-S

MOBILE DISCHARGE MEASUREMENT SYSTEM FOR TURBULENT RIVERS WITH UNKNOWN CROSS-SECTION PROFILE – SALT TRACER

The discharge measurement is performed by using the well-established tracer-dilution method. The system can be deployed in turbulent rivers, creeks or waters for which data regarding the cross-section profile are not available or unknown. It is used salt (NaCl) as tracer material. After insertion of a known amount of tracer material two conductivity probes automatically determine the discharge. This way high plausibility and accurate results can be guaranteed. TECHNICAL DETAILS TQ-S

GENERAL

  • Mesasuring principle tracer dilution method with instantaneous feed
  • Application discharges up to 10 m³/s

TQ-AMP (MEASUREMENT DEVICE WITH BLUETOOTH-TRANSMISSION)

  • Memory capacity none (data storage in the receiving device)
  • Tranmsission interval 1 second
  • Data transfer Bluetooth class 1 (transmission range up to 100m)
  • Operating temperature -20 … +60 °C
  • Protection IP66
  • Energy supply 3x 1.5 V batteries, size AA or 3x 1.5 V / 2700 mAh NiMH batteries, size AA
  • Operation time 50 hrs (with 3x 2500 mAh batteries)
  • Charging time approx. 10 hrs
